Understanding Sash Windows
Sash windows, typically made of wood, consist of one or more movable panels or sashes that move vertically or horizontally. They permit excellent ventilation while preserving security. Sash windows are normally categorized into two primary types:
Single-Hung Sash Windows: These have one fixed sash and one operable sash that slides up and down.Double-Hung Sash Windows: Both sashes can slide up and down, providing more versatile ventilation choices.Advantages of Sash WindowsAesthetic Appeal: They boost the appeal of a home, particularly period residential or commercial properties.Ventilation: Their design promotes natural airflow.Energy Efficiency: Well-maintained sash windows can improve insulation and lower energy expenses.Typical Issues with Sash Windows
In time, sash windows might come across a range of problems consisting of:
IssueDescriptionDecayed FramesWooden frames can weaken due to water damage.Damaged CordsThe systems that permit windows to run smoothly might wear out or break.DraftsPoor insulation and sealing can lead to drafts, making the home less energy effective.Paint PeelingUse and tear can cause the paint to peel, exposing wood to weather damage.Sash StickingIssues with alignment can lead to sashes being hard to open or close.
Comprehending these issues allows property owners to determine when repairs are required and what services to look for.

Average Repair Costs
While costs can vary significantly depending on the nature of the repairs, the following table supplies a basic summary of what you might anticipate to pay for typical sash window repairs:
Repair TypeTypical CostDecomposed Frame Replacement₤ 250 - ₤ 750 per windowSash Cord Repl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 250 per windowWeatherstripping Installation₤ 75 - ₤ 200 per windowPainting and Finishing₤ 150 - ₤ 350 per windowComplete Window Restoration₤ 500 - ₤ 1,500 per window
Rates can vary based on location, the condition of the windows, and the specific services required.
